Understanding the Symbolism of a Van
In the realm of dream interpretation, vehicles are powerful symbols representing the direction and control we have in our lives. Specifically, a van, which is often associated with collective transportation, embodies the concepts of travel, freedom, and the journey of life. The appearance of a van in a dream can serve as a mirror reflecting the dreamer’s current state of independence and their navigation through personal challenges and responsibilities.
The symbolism of the van can vary greatly depending on its attributes within the dream. For instance, a well-maintained and spacious van may represent the dreamer’s sense of adventure and openness to new experiences. In contrast, a dilapidated or abandoned van could signify feelings of stagnation or unmet responsibilities. Additionally, the dreamer’s emotions and interactions with the van throughout the dream play a crucial role in its interpretation. Positive feelings such as excitement or anticipation can indicate a readiness to embark on a new path, while feelings of anxiety or distress may reflect apprehension about life’s journey.
Moreover, dreaming of a van can also speak to the dreamer’s social connections and community ties. Since vans are designed to accommodate multiple passengers, they may symbolize the influence of relationships in one’s life. This aspect is especially poignant if the dreamer finds themselves traveling with familiar faces, emphasizing the importance of shared experiences. Alternatively, solitude within the van may resonate with feelings of isolation or a desire for independence.
Overall, understanding the nuance of the van’s symbolism reveals much about the dreamer’s psyche and their approach to life’s journey. By examining the characteristics of the van in the dream alongside the dreamer’s emotional response, we can uncover deeper insights into their personal development and existential path.

Dream Interpretation Techniques: Tracing the Steps
Dream interpretation has long fascinated individuals seeking to grasp the underlying meanings behind their subconscious messages. Various techniques can aid in unraveling the complexities of dreams, allowing dreamers to connect their nocturnal experiences to real-life circumstances, particularly with symbolic representations like a van in a desert.
One prevalent approach to dream interpretation is symbolism analysis. This method involves examining the images, objects, and scenarios within the dream to derive potential meanings. For instance, a van may symbolize travel, freedom, or a journey through life’s challenges, while a desert might represent solitude, abandonment, or the search for clarity. By identifying these symbols and reflecting on their significance, individuals can shift their focus from surface-level observations to deeper insights into their personal circumstances.
Another effective technique is evaluating emotional responses during the dream. Dreamers often experience a range of feelings, from fear and anxiety to joy and peace. By carefully assessing these emotions, one could glean insights regarding their current emotional state or unresolved issues in waking life. For instance, feeling lost in a desert can highlight feelings of isolation or uncertainty about one’s path, prompting reflective discussions on how these emotions manifest in day-to-day activities.
Moreover, the personal association technique encourages individuals to connect dream symbols with their unique life experiences. Each person brings their own history, beliefs, and emotions to the interpretation process. For instance, if someone associates vans with family road trips in childhood, dreaming of a van may evoke nostalgic or irrational feelings. Recognizing these personal connections can foster a deeper understanding of the dream’s relevance to their life.
Through these diverse techniques, individuals can navigate their dream landscapes more effectively, providing them with valuable insights that resonate with their reality. By employing a combination of symbolism analysis, emotional evaluations, and personal associations, individuals can unlock the mysteries behind dreams involving symbols such as a van in a desert.
